What is a Private Limited Company?
A Private Limited Company is the most preferred business structure for startups and growing businesses in India. Registered under the Companies Act, 2013, and regulated by the Ministry of Corporate Affairs (MCA), it gives your business a distinct legal identity — separate from its founders — while limiting each shareholder's liability to the value of their shares.
This structure is trusted by investors, banks, and enterprise customers alike, making it the natural choice for founders planning to raise capital, build a credible brand, or scale beyond a single founder.
Key Features
- Separate legal identity from its owners
- Limited liability protection for shareholders
- Minimum 2 and maximum 200 shareholders
- Minimum 2 directors, at least one resident in India
- No minimum paid-up capital requirement
- Easiest structure to raise venture funding
Why Choose a Private Limited Company
A structure built for businesses that intend to grow, raise capital, and last.
Limited Liability
Your personal assets stay protected — liability is limited to your shareholding.
Easier to Raise Funding
The preferred structure for angel investors, VCs, and institutional funding.
Separate Legal Entity
The company can own property, sue, and be sued independently of its founders.
Enhanced Credibility
Builds trust with banks, vendors, and enterprise clients from day one.
Perpetual Succession
The company continues to exist regardless of changes in ownership or directors.
Tax Efficiency
Access to structured deductions and exemptions available only to companies.

Frequently Asked Questions
How long does Private Limited Company registration take?
Typically 7–10 working days from the time all documents are submitted, depending on Registrar of Companies (ROC) processing time and name approval.
Do I need a physical office to register a company?
No. You can use a residential address as your registered office. You will need a recent utility bill and an NOC from the owner.
Can a foreign national be a director?
Yes. A foreign national can be a director, provided at least one director on the board is a resident of India (has stayed in India for 182+ days in the previous financial year).
What is the minimum capital required?
There is no minimum paid-up capital requirement under the Companies Act, 2013. You can start with any amount you choose.
What compliance is required after incorporation?
